last-child 예제

다음은 실제 세계의 예입니다 : nth-child 선택기 : 3n – 2이 CSS : 마지막 자식 예제에서 마지막 태그 내에있는 텍스트 „checkyourmath.com”은 빨간색 굵은 텍스트로 표시됩니다. 첫 번째 태그 내의 텍스트는 :last-child 선택기에서 스타일을 조정하지 않습니다. 양수로 전달할 수 있습니다 :nth-child() 인수로 전달할 수 있으며, 이 요소는 부모 내의 인덱스가 :nth-child()의 인수와 일치하는 요소를 선택합니다. 예를 들어 li:nth-child(3)는 인덱스 값 3을 가진 목록 항목을 선택합니다. 즉, 세 번째 목록 항목을 선택합니다. :nth-child()를 사용하면 인수로 전달되는 수식(또는 수식)-+b-를 사용하여 하나 이상의 요소를 선택할 수도 있습니다. 구문은 :nth-child(an+b)로, a와 b를 고유의 정수 값으로 바꿔 n이 양수(0, 1, 2, 3 등)로 대체된 후 결과 숫자는 선택하려는 요소의 인덱스입니다. 예를 들어 :nth-child(3n+1)는 1차(3*0+1 = 1) 자식, 4번째(3*1 +1 = 4) 어린이, 7번째(3*2 +1 = 7) 자식 등을 선택합니다. 지금까지 당신은 이미 : nth-child 선택기로 할 수있는 몇 가지 흥미로운 것들을 생각하고있을 수 있지만 그렇지 않다면 몇 가지 예를 정리했습니다. 그들은 기본 시작하지만 더 복잡해진다. 이 CSS :last-child 예제에서 마지막 행(예: 마지막

태그)은 노란색 배경색을 갖습니다. 테이블의 다른 모든 행은 :last-child 선택기에서 스타일을 조정하지 않습니다.

:last-child 의사 클래스는 다른 의사 클래스와 마찬가지로 :hover와 같은 다른 선택기와 연결하여 선택한 요소에 대한 호버 스타일을 제공할 수 있습니다. 또한 의사 요소로 묶일 수도 있습니다 ::이전 및 ::After. 아래 예제 및 라이브 데모 섹션을 참조하세요. 위의 규칙은 .container 부모의 첫 번째 자식이 아니므로 다음 예제에서 단락의 스타일을 정하지 않습니다. 예를 들어 다음 이미지는 항목 목록에서 li:nth-child(3n+1)를 선택한 결과를 보여 주며 있습니다. 목록에는 10개의 항목이 있으며 = 3이 있으므로 10개의 항목은 3으로 나뉩니다. 10/3 = 3 + 1, 그래서 자신의 마지막 그룹으로 그룹화 될 하나의 항목이 남아있을 것입니다. 그런 다음 네 그룹 각각에 대해 첫 번째 항목이 선택됩니다. 다음 이미지에서 일치하는 항목은 카키 배경을 가지고 있습니다. 컨테이너 내부의 마지막 단락을 선택하고 스타일을 지정하려면 마지막 자식인지 여부에 관계없이 이름에서 알 수 있듯이 해당 형식의 마지막 요소를 선택하여 부모의 마지막 자식인지 여부에 관계없이 :Last-of-type 선택기를 사용할 수 있습니다. 예를 들어 p:last-of-type은 위의 소스 코드 예제에서 정렬되지 않은 목록 앞에 오는 단락을 선택하지만 그 앞에 오는 다른 단락과 일치하지 는 않습니다.

요소에 표시 속성이 없음으로 설정되어 있으면 작동하지 않습니다. 여전히 숨겨진 요소를 마지막 자식으로 간주합니다. 나는 기술적으로 그것이 정확하다고 생각하지만 많은 경우에 의도하지 않은 것 같아요. 우리는 첫 번째와 함께 보다 효율적인 방법으로이 작업을 수행 할 수 있습니다 그리고 그것은 우리가 추가하거나이 정렬되지 않은 목록에서 제거 얼마나 많은 목록 항목 중요하지 않습니다, 부모 내부의 첫 번째 자식 div 요소를 대상으로, 우리는 쓸 수 있습니다 : 나는 더 많은 li를 사용하는 방법 (전 3 li) 그래서 이제 목록으로 돌아가 페이지를 새로 고칠 때. 이 비디오에서는 :first-child 및 :마지막 자식 구조 의사 클래스를 사용하여 첫 번째 및 마지막 자식 요소를 대상으로 지정하는 방법을 알아봅니다. 그러나 전체 콘텐츠에서 단락이 제거되므로 주의해야 합니다. 여기에 필터에 대한 워드 프레스 참조입니다 : 이제 우리는 인덱스 점 HTML 파일을 보면 우리는 :nth-child()에 대한 마크 업이 자신의 컨테이너 내부의 인덱스 (소스 순서)에 따라 요소를 선택할 수있는 CSS 의사 클래스 선택기임을 볼 수 있습니다. :n번째 자식 셀렉터는 강력하고 사용하기 쉽습니다. 그것은 우리가 서로에 관하여 그들의 순서에 따라 특정 요소를 대상으로 할 수 있습니다. 우리는 2 번째 (2, 7, 12, 17,…)에서 시작하여 모든 5 번째 아이처럼 4 번째 어린이 또는 좀 더 복잡한 것과 같은 간단한 것을 대상으로 할 수 있습니다.

Posted in Bez kategorii